On 'Shinsangchulsi Pyeonstaurant,' singer Kim Yong-bin opens up about the difficult past he endured due to panic disorder.

According to the production team of KBS 2TV's variety program 'Shinsangchulsi Pyeonstaurant' (hereinafter 'Pyeonstaurant') on the 30th, the episode airing on May 1 will feature the story of Kim Yong-bin, who won the grand prize in the TV Chosun competition program 'Mr. Trot 3.' Kim Yong-bin is set to share sincere stories about the trials he faced during his 23-year journey as a trot artist and the reasons he was able to overcome them.

In a VCR released during a recent recording, Kim Yong-bin warmly welcomed his friend Choo Hyeok-jin, who had traveled all the way from Daegu just for him. The two became close while appearing together on a trot competition program and are best friends of the same age. Choo Hyeok-jin, the son of a meat restaurant owner, brought a plentiful amount of delicious meat for Kim Yong-bin, while Kim Yong-bin showcased his skills as a 'chicken chef' and prepared various dishes.

Following this, the two began sharing nostalgic stories. Although both are currently busy as leading trot singers, they admitted there were times that were incredibly difficult for them. Kim Yong-bin said, "After graduating from middle school, I went to Japan to pursue singing. It was really hard back then." He explained that not only did he face financial hardships, but he also suddenly went through puberty, which made it impossible for him to sing, and at a young age, he even suffered from panic disorder.

Kim Yong-bin recalled, "I couldn't do anything for seven years and stayed at home," providing detailed accounts of that period. Choo Hyeok-jin also shared, "I was nurturing my dream of becoming a singer, but during my 20s when I had no money, I survived each day on just one bento box." It is reported that the 'Pyeonstaurant' cast members poured out their support upon hearing the two's honest stories. The episode will air on May 1 at 8:30 p.m.
